%O Era digital saat ini mendorong dikembangkannya inovasi pengembangan bahan ajar digital yang harus direspons dengan peningkatan literasi digital siswa. Penelitian ini bertujuan untuk mengembangkan prototype Biolita Book, mengetahui kelayakan prototype berdasarkan penilaian uji ahli materi, ahli media, dan respons pengguna (guru dan siswa) sebagai bahan ajar interaktif untuk menunjang literasi digital siswa pada materi perubahan lingkungan. Metode yang digunakan dalam penelitian ini yaitu metode R&D (Research and Development) dengan desain penelitian model 3D (define, design, dan development). Penelitian ini dilaksanakan sejak bulan April – Desember 2024 di SMAN 4 Kota Cilegon dan di Universitas Sultan Ageng Tirtayasa. Subjek penelitian terdiri dari 3 ahli materi, 3 ahli media, 2 guru biologi, dan 15 siswa kelas X SMAN 4 Kota Cilegon. Hasil penilaian kelayakan produk menunjukkan bahwa ahli materi dan ahli media masing-masing mendapatkan nilai rata-rata sebesar 93%. Adapun penilaian uji respons pengguna mendapatkan nilai rata-rata keseluruhan sebesar 90%, dengan nilai rata-rata 89% oleh siswa dan 91% oleh guru. This study aims to develop a Biolita Book prototype, determine the feasibility of the prototype based on the test assessment of material experts, media experts, and user responses (teachers and students) as interactive teaching materials to support students' digital literacy on environmental change material. The method used in this research was the R&D (Research and Development) method with a 3D model research design (define, design, and development). This research was conducted from April to December 2024 at SMAN 4 Cilegon City and at Sultan Ageng Tirtayasa University. The research subjects consisted of 3 material experts, 3 media experts, 2 biology teachers, and 15 students of class X SMAN 4 Cilegon City. The results of the product feasibility assessment showed that the material experts and media experts each received an average score of 93%. The user response test assessment received an overall average score of 90%, with an average score of 89% by students and 91% by teachers.
